[Цитировать]

    sergeysvirid
  • 104
  • Стаж: 9 лет
  • Сообщений: 2582
  • Репутация:127

    [+] [-]
  • Откуда: 65 регион (GMT+11)
11912Я всегда разворачивал образ на флешку, то есть на флешке перед установкой лежал не образ ISO, а файлы из самого образа, затем устанавливал
А, ну это совсем другое дело, я то подумал, что Вы используете для установки именно целиком образ (.iso) Windows.
Ну тогда можете попробовать хоть, как Вы хотите (конвертировать в .swm), хоть как я предлагаю (конвертировать в .esd) и попробовать устанавливать из папки _WIN (вот из этого сборника: Multiboot Collection Full)-P.S.
Не пугайтесь размера раздачи, (она раздаётся папками) и для установки Windows Вам из этой раздачи нужна только папка _WIN, EFI и файл BOOTMGR в корне сборника). Остальное можете не качать.


Последний раз редактировалось: sergeysvirid (2015-10-09 12:59), всего редактировалось 1 раз

[Цитировать]

    sergeysvirid
  • 104
  • Стаж: 9 лет
  • Сообщений: 2582
  • Репутация:127

    [+] [-]
  • Откуда: 65 регион (GMT+11)
11915Я беру Multiboot Collection Lite, кладу в папку WIN install.wim или install.esd или install.swm, и затем спокойно с этой флешки FAT32 устанавливаюсь в режиме GPT-UEFI?
Да, только попробуйте Multiboot Collection Full
Для установочных файлов install.wim или install.esd или install.swm в папке _WIN лежат пустые подпапки (можете создать свои, со своими именами, это подпапки в качестве примера), вот в них и кладёте свои install.wim или install.esd или install.swm
А в саму папку _WIN можете накидать любых образов Windows (кол-во в принципе не ограничено, как образов, так и установочных файлов install.wim/esd/swm)
И ещё для установки в UEFI-режиме, Вам из этого сборника нужна будет (обязательно) папка EFI

[Цитировать]

    Гость
  • Репутация:0

    [+] [-]
kolaider, правильно. Папки внутри - чистая условность. При запуске 78setup просканирует содержимое ВСЕХ корневых папок _WIN, включая все подкаталоги (имя трех папок для поиска архивов или образов можно изменить в _WIN\78SETUP.CFG), будет произведен поиск WIM/SWM/RWM/ESD и bin/nrg/iso, найденные будут добавлены в меню установки из архива или из образа.
Из-под BIOS (или UEFI в режиме LegacyBoot) можно установить 32/64-битовую версию ОС (без поддержки UEFI-загрузки). Если загрузить сборку в EFI-режиме, то ОС тоже будет установлена с поддержкой EFI-загрузки. Применительно к ПК/ноутбукам - UEFIx64, ОС тоже должна устанавливаться х64.

Небольшая справка по UEFI и GPT

UEFI - это мини-ОС на базе Linux, задача которой запустить загрузчик. Загрузчиком служит файл из папки efi\boot: bootx64.efi для UEFIx64 или bootia32.efi для UEFIx32. Также в совместимом режиме Legacy Mode (если он поддерживается UEFI, зачастую это реализовано в x64-версии) возможна эмуляция Bios-загрузки (загрузка из MBR).
UEFI поддерживает загрузку ОС как с GPT-разделов (только из разделов FAT/FAT32), так и MBR HDD (если поддерживается Legacy Mode).
Примечание: в классической реализации UEFI отсутствуют драйверы NTFS, поэтому такие разделы UEFI просто "не увидит" (и, соответственно, не сможет из них загрузиться). Некоторые производители (в новых реализациях UEFI) могут включать этот драйвер, тогда на таких ПК можно загрузиться и с NTFS-разделов. Но для гарантированной загрузки на различных ПК лучше форматировать загрузочный носитель в FAT/FAT32.
BIOS позволяет загружаться только из MBR-записи HDD. Хотя, после загрузки ОС на базе Windows 7 и выше, может полноценно работать и с GPT-разделами HDD HDD.
Примечание: работа с GPT-разделами также реализована в ОС Windows 2003 Server, но с некоторыми ограничениями (размер HDD не более 3Тб).
Возможность загрузки и работы ОС в EFI-режиме реализована в ОС Windows 8 и новее (8.1, 10, ...), а также с ограничениями - в ОС Windows 7x64 (для 7x86 эта возможность отсутствует). Ограничения для Windows 7x64 связаны с тем, что в этой ОС еще не было цифровых подписей файлов, поэтому загрузка и работа EFI-версии 7x64 возможна лишь при условии отключения Secure Boot (которая занимается проверкой цифровой подписи).
Чтобы установить EFI-ОС, необходимо загружать WinPE только в EFI-режиме.
32-битный процессор (что равнозначно UEFIx32, обычно устанавливаются на планшеты) - возможна EFI-загрузка исключительно х86-разрядных PE/ОС (загрузчик bootia32.efi), можно загрузить WinPE/ОС на базе 8-ки и новее.
64-битный процессор (что равнозначно UEFIx64, практически все новые ПК и ноутбуки) - возможна EFI-загрузка исключительно х64-разрядных PE/ОС (загрузчик bootx64.efi), можно загружать WinPE/ОС на базе 8-ки и новее (либо 7x64 с отключеным "Secure Boot").
Примечание: в UEFIx64 отсутствует поддержка x32, поэтому использование каких-либо x32-версий EFI-утилит полностью исключено. То же касается использования в UEFIx32 64-битовых версий.
Порядок загрузки в EFI-режиме и установки EFI ОС:
1. Загружается загрузчик (соответствующей разрядности), который находится по пути efi\boot\bootx64.efi (х64) или efi\boot\bootia32.efi (х32)
2. Загрузчик загружает своё меню BCD (файл efi\microsoft\boot\BCD).
Примечание: для WinPE-сборок, в которых совмещена возможность загрузки как в x64, так и в x32 режимах, часто применяют пропатченную версию bootia32.efi. В пропатченной версии изменено имя меню BCD на B32, что позволяет разделить менюшки по разрядности (BCD - меню для x64, и B32 - для x32-реализации UEFI). Применение патча именно для bootia32.efi допустимо, поскольку проверка цифровой подписи (Secure Boot) в x32-реализациях UEFI отсутствует (по крайней мере, пока не встречается).
3. Из меню загружается ядро (например, boot.wim), в котором должен быть EFI-загрузчик для загрузки в EFI-режиме (как и в install.wim/esd, он находится по пути Windows\System32\Boot\winload.efi).
4. Только из WinPE, загруженного в EFI-режиме, возможно установить EFI-версию ОС. При этом в установочном архиве (install.wim/esd), обязательно должен присутствовать EFI-загрузчик ядра (Windows\System32\Boot\winload.efi), а разрядность ОС должна соответствовать реализации UEFI (x64 или x32). EFI-загрузчик ядра есть в Windows 7 x64 и в более новых 8/8.1/10.
Примечание: стоит учитывать ограничения на установку EFI ОС 7x64 (необходимо отключение Secure Boot, иначе установленная ОС не сможет загружаться).

[Цитировать]

    Гость
  • Репутация:0

    [+] [-]
kolaider, почему не получится? FAT32, образы и/или архивы до 4Гб. Либо перешить флешку сервисной утилитой как HDD и два раздела - FAT32 для загрузочной части и NTFS для больших файлов (образы/архивы). Еще раз напомню, что 78setup просканирует ВСЕ папки _WIN на всех разделах (доступных для РЕ/ОС - именно поэтому нужно сменить тип флешки на USB-HDD). Подобрать утилитку для флешки можно на www.usbdev.ru.

[Цитировать]

    Jurik43
  • 115
  • Стаж: 9 лет
  • Сообщений: 87
  • Репутация:0

    [+] [-]
  • Откуда: Саранск
Всем привет.
kolaider, Вам уже наверное сюда или сюда

[Цитировать]

    Joker-2013
  • 1039
  • Стаж: 9 лет 5 месяцев
  • Сообщений: 2053
  • Репутация:120

    [+] [-]
  • Откуда: из прошлого
kolaider, А к чему вам это GPT???
FAT32 и MBR, достаточно.
Не люблю я Rufus, раньше выкладывал со своими сборками.
Так пользователи задолбали вопросами.
Обновлять или не обновлять, как настроить.
Да и сам им пользоваться не могу...
Хочу флешку FAT32, а программа форматирует в NTFS.
Навязывает нам то что она хочет, а не мы...
Этот факт очень огорчает.
Кодер, конечно молодец. Но... Я бы не рекомендовал.
Пару флешек, данной утилитой я убил... Но, к счастью нашел прошивки и они ожили вновь...

[Цитировать]

    Гость
  • Репутация:0

    [+] [-]
kolaider, саму флешку необходимо готовить в FAT32, как MBR/Bios-загрузочную (установить загрузчиком bootmgr). Плюс папка EFI на ней - позволит загружать в режимах UEFIx32/UEFIx64 (загрузчики bootia32.efi / bootx64.efi соответственно). Рекомендую еще раз внимательно перечитать "Небольшую справку по UEFI и GPT".
Joker-2013, иногда, в случаях проблем после форматирования, помогает очистка первого мегабайта флешки. UTmake делает это автоматически при переразбивке.


Последний раз редактировалось: Гость (2015-10-11 10:41), всего редактировалось 2 раз(а)

[Цитировать]

    sergeysvirid
  • 104
  • Стаж: 9 лет
  • Сообщений: 2582
  • Репутация:127

    [+] [-]
  • Откуда: 65 регион (GMT+11)
12011Я так понял, нужно по любому две флешки, 1- для MBR BIOS, 2- для GPT UEFI. Одну - для всех случаев не получится.
Да как же не получится?
Вам же conty9 всё растолковал в "Небольшая справка по UEFI и GPT"
Установка в EFI-режиме (на диск с разметкой GPT) отличается от установки в обычном BIOS-режиме (на диск с разметкой MBR) только лишь режимом загрузки.
Примерная цепочка загрузки (применимо к Multiboot Collection Full):
BIOS:
BOOTMGR --> \_WIN\BCD --> выбор пункта меню "MS-DaRT for Windows 8.1 (x64) or Setup Windows" --> \_WIN\BOOT8164.WIM --> выбор вашего install.wim/esd/swm (который находится в любой подпапке папки _WIN) в окне утилиты 78Setup --> Классическая установка Windows на диск с разметкой MBR
UEFI:
\EFI\boot\bootx64.efi --> \EFI\microsoft\boot\BCD --> выбор пункта меню "MS-DaRT for Windows 8.1 (x64) or Setup Windows" --> \_WIN\BOOT8164.WIM --> выбор вашего install.wim/esd/swm (который находится в любой подпапке папки _WIN) в окне утилиты 78Setup --> Классическая установка Windows на диск с разметкой GPT-А так как у Вас на флешке будет корневой BOOTMGR и папка _WIN (что обеспечит Вам установку в BIOS-режиме загрузки) и будет папка EFI (что обеспечит Вам установку в UEFI-режиме загрузки) - это и получается, что у Вас будет одна флешка "для всех случаев".

[Цитировать]

    V-N-G
  • 1126
  • Стаж: 9 лет 4 месяца
  • Сообщений: 45
  • Репутация:1

    [+] [-]
conty9, есть ли возможность сделать функцию "выключить компьютер" по завершении задачи?

[Цитировать]

    Гость
  • Репутация:0

    [+] [-]
SunOK, V-N-G, Павел, проверяйте - версия 1.9.1 (ссылка обновлена), с функцией выхода/выключения/перезагрузки по завершению перепаковки. Устанавливается в любой момент (ДО или ПОСЛЕ начала перепаковки) кнопкой 'When done' (выбираем желаемый режим, применяем). Работает только при выполнении операций перепаковки. Есть индикация режима. При прерывании процесса упаковки "сбрасывается". При удачном завершении перепаковки выводится таймер обратного отсчета (10 мин.), также можно отменить выключение/перезагрузку (Cancel либо нажатие на клавиатуре Enter или Space)... либо применить её немедленно.


Последний раз редактировалось: Гость (2015-10-30 20:53), всего редактировалось 2 раз(а)

[Цитировать]

    AlexGen
  • 2175
  • Стаж: 8 лет 11 месяцев
  • Сообщений: 3
  • Репутация:0

    [+] [-]
Приветствую господа.
С Новым годом всех!
У меня вопрос к conty9.
В вашей утилите 78RePack параметр "Convert to ESD (Windows 8-10)" использует командную строку:
wimlib-imagex.exe export D:\Image\install.wim all D:\Image\install.esd --recompress --solid
или...?
И еще одно наблюдение...
wimlib, по моему мнению, не может организовать конвертацию wim в esd с одинаковыми именами выпусков Windows 32 и 64 бит, находящимся в образе install.wim. Ну скажем на примере Windows 8.1.
DISM это делает без проблем.
Можно ли как-то обойти эту засаду...
С уваж. ab

[Цитировать]

    Гость
  • Репутация:0

    [+] [-]
AlexGen, при конвертации в ESD используются такие ключи запуска:
wimlib-imagex.exe export "D:\Image\install.wim" all "D:\Image\install.esd" --compress=LZMS:100 --solid
По второму вопросу - не понял... впрочем, думаю, его нужно адресовать автору wimlib.

[Цитировать]

    dem0n43
  • 556
  • Стаж: 9 лет 7 месяцев
  • Сообщений: 65
  • Репутация:2

    [+] [-]
  • Откуда: ИзЗАДА
AlexGen, когда собирал с одинаковым именем то ставил пробел в конце все прокатывало

[Цитировать]

    AlexGen
  • 2175
  • Стаж: 8 лет 11 месяцев
  • Сообщений: 3
  • Репутация:0

    [+] [-]
conty9,
Благодарю за ответ.
Dism, по моему, использует метод сжатия LZMS:17. Ну да ладно...
По поводу второго.
Имелось ввиду выпуски Windows 8.1, 32 и 64 бит в одном образе install.wim с одинаковыми названиями выпусков (Редакций)
Например
name: Windows 8.1
name: Windows 8.1 Профессиональная
и т.д.
Чтобы пережать wimlib-ом нужно изменить названия редакций 64 бит:
Пример:
name: Windows 8.1 (64-bit)
name: Windows 8.1 Профессиональная (64-bit)
Т.е. в данном случае добавление к имени: (64-bit)
Для Dism этого не требуется.
--------------------------------------------------
dem0n43,
Спасибо.
Непременно испробую.

[Цитировать]

    dem0n43
  • 556
  • Стаж: 9 лет 7 месяцев
  • Сообщений: 65
  • Репутация:2

    [+] [-]
  • Откуда: ИзЗАДА
AlexGen, Собирал WinToolkitом добавлял пробел и прокатывало пережимал 78RePack

Страница 7 из 22


Показать сообщения:    

Текущее время: 23-Ноя 21:28

Часовой пояс: UTC + 3


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ы можете скачивать файлы